Federal Government Set To Restructure NYSC, Minister Announces

During the opening ceremony of the inaugural meeting between NYSC management and heads of corps-producing institutions in Nigeria, Minister of Youth Development, Dr. Jamila Ibrahim, unveiled the Federal Government’s intention to conduct a comprehensive review, restructuring, and reform of the National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) to align with future needs….READ ALSO Federal Government To Remove Naira From Peer-To-Peer Platforms Amid FX Crisis

 

 

Dr. Ibrahim announced that a team would be inaugurated to spearhead the review, with a primary focus on fostering an entrepreneurial mindset among participants and prioritizing skills development within the program. Additionally, he revealed plans to financially support over 5000 corps members in their entrepreneurial ventures, with funding of up to N10 million each.

The Minister emphasized the government’s vision for the NYSC to evolve into a self-sustained and revenue-generating program within the next five years. To achieve this goal, efforts would be directed towards institutionalizing NYSC ventures as an investment and asset management outfit.

Brigadier General Yushau Ahmed, Director-General of NYSC, highlighted the purpose of the meeting, aimed at improving the mobilization process of prospective corps members. He stressed the need to address identified challenges and ensure a seamless mobilization process, with active involvement from chief executives of corps-producing institutions.

Reaffirming NYSC’s commitment to the security and welfare of corps members, Ahmed urged stakeholders to collaborate in sensitizing young graduates on the importance of adhering to safety measures during national service deployments.

Representing the Federal Capital Territory, FCT, Nyesom Ezenwo Wike commended NYSC management for selecting Abuja as the meeting venue. He underscored the importance of innovative strategies to overcome challenges and enhance the engagement of young graduates in national development efforts, urging participants to actively contribute to the meeting’s success.
